def sync_query_tencent_cloud_data(config, sql, params, result_queue, task_id):
"""
同步查询腾讯云TDLC数据(兼容单/多线程)
:param config: TDLC连接配置
:param sql: 含%s占位符的SQL语句
:param params: SQL参数列表(用于替换%s
:param result_queue: 线程安全的结果队列(单线程传None)
:param task_id: 任务ID(区分不同查询,单线程可传任意字符串)
"""
conn = None
cursor = None
try:
# (原连接/执行SQL逻辑完全不变)
conn = tdlc_connector.connect(
**config,
engine_type=constants.EngineType.SPARK,
result_style=constants.ResultStyles.LIST
)
cursor = conn.cursor()
# print(f"[线程-{task_id}] 执行SQL: {sql} | 参数: {params}")
cursor.execute(sql, params)
columns = [desc[0] for desc in cursor.description] if cursor.description else []
results = cursor.fetchall()
dict_results = [dict(zip(columns, row)) for row in results]
# ===== 仅新增:判断队列是否为空,兼容单线程 =====
if result_queue is not None:
# 多线程:结果入队
result_queue.put({
"task_id": task_id,
"success": True,
"data": dict_results,
"error": None
})
else:
# 单线程:直接返回结果(新增返回逻辑)
return {
"success": True,
"data": dict_results,
"error": None
}
except Exception as e:
error_info = f"{str(e)}\n{traceback.format_exc()}"
print(f"[线程-{task_id}] 查询失败: {error_info}")
# ===== 同样新增:队列空判断 =====
if result_queue is not None:
result_queue.put({
"task_id": task_id,
"success": False,
"data": None,
"error": error_info
})
else:
return {
"success": False,
"data": None,
"error": error_info
}
finally:
# (原关闭连接逻辑完全不变)
if cursor:
try:
cursor.close()
except Exception as e:
print(f"[线程-{task_id}] 关闭游标失败: {str(e)}")
if conn:
try:
conn.close()
except Exception as e:
print(f"[线程-{task_id}] 关闭连接失败: {str(e)}")
